1956 Map of San Jose

USGS Topo · Published 1956

This historical map portrays the area of San Jose in 1956, primarily covering Santa Clara County as well as portions of Alameda County, Contra Costa County, Fresno County, Calaveras County, San Joaquin County, Stanislaus County, Merced County, Santa Cruz County, Madera County, Tuolumne County, and Mariposa County. Featuring a scale of 1:250000, this map provides a highly detailed snapshot of the terrain, roads, buildings, counties, and historical landmarks in the San Jose region at the time. Published in 1956, it is the sole known edition of this map.
